Quoted:
Thanks guys. Just checked and nothing to be had on island. I'll have to fab something ot wait another week if i order. If you have a piece of paper and some tape, you should be just fine till you get something nice. If you use heavy paper, and make the opening just small enough to get into the case mouth, you will be okay. The stick powders can bridge, but the point is you can clear the funnel with a little technique. |
